Three local Hurriyat leaders arrested in Poonch
Srinagar, Jul 7: Police detained three local Hurriyat leaders on Wednesday, Jul 7 who were allegedly planning to enforce a bandh in Surankote town of Poonch district.
Police raided the houses of three leaders in Surankote town and arrested them. The detained leaders include Hanief Kalas, Irshad Hussain and Omar.
The Hurriyat leaders wanted to enforce bandh in Surankote town in support of Hurriyat's call for a bandh in Kashmir valley.
Parbeet Singh, Surankore DSP, said that police had to detain them in order to maintain law and order in the district.
